The Alaska Cruise & Travel Show

Vancouver, BC: Saturday, March 11, 2023
Seattle, WA: Saturday, March 18, 2023

Pan for real gold as they do in Fairbanks, try axe-throwing as you can in Ketchikan, or snack on gooey s’mores around a campfire like at McKinley Chalet Resort. Hear more about the incredible moments you’ll get to experience on a beautiful Alaska cruise or cruisetour from local partners and tour operators. Information about summer job opportunities in Alaska and the Yukon will also be available.

Alaska Summer Job Fair

Many of our Exhibitor partners will be hiring for the 2023 summer season – a great opportunity for students, retirees, or anyone looking for a paid adventure in the Last Frontier! Make sure to pick up the Summer Jobs flyer at the show entrance to see who’s hiring!
